It is easier than you think to capture fireworks photos with today's digital cameras - my tips are (1) take a tripod, (2) use the self-timer and (3) take a lot of photos, you'll be surprised how many turn out OK but more is always better. And be sure that you have fresh batteries and a big memory card!
